A book specially written to help YOU give up busyness in just one hour and get your life back!

Following the success of his previous book, Beyond Busyness: Time Wisdom for Ministry, Dr Stephen Cherry has distilled the essence of Time Wisdom into this bite-sized book, essential for anyone seeking to restore some balance in their busy life.

Why give up busyness?
You might just find you get more done...

Busyness has become a disease.
The developed world is suffering from an epidemic of major proportions, and the disease at the heart of it is busyness. We are addicted to doing one thing after another with as little down-time as possible. This is a sickness, a spiritual sickness.

Why is busyness so bad?

  • It distorts your perception
  • It makes you feel self-important
  • It makes you rude
  • It's an excuse for impatience
  • It's an excuse for not getting things done
  • It's addictive
  • It burns you out
  • It's lazy - chronic busyness occurs when you have not asked the important questions or decided on your priorities

About the Author
Stephen Cherry is a Canon of Durham Cathedral and is responsible for the ongoing development of ministers in the Diocese of Durham, and author of Healing Agony and the Archbishop of Canterbury's 2011 Lent Book, Barefoot Disciple.

Stephen has degrees in Psychology and Theology, and a PhD on the theology and practice of forgiveness.
